Job Duties
Manage the development, review and communication of provincial and transversal Human Resource (HR) policies, strategies, frameworks and guidelines to ensure alignment with national and provincial prescripts.Oversee the monitoring and evaluation of compliance with HR policies, frameworks, strategies and procedures across Gauteng Provincial Government (GPG) departments, and provide strategic advice and interventions where gaps are identified.
Manage the provision of strategic Human Resource Planning and Reporting services by assessing departmental HR Plans in line with DPSA requirements, providing feedback to departments, monitoring implementation, consolidating reports and coordinating submissions to the DPSA.
Oversee the management of Human Resource Management Information Systems (HRMIS) and the analysis of workforce information, including vacancy rates, turnover rates, headcounts, employment equity, demographic trends and other HR indicators, to support evidence-based decision-making.
Develop and coordinate HR interventions based on workforce analytics and provide strategic guidance and recommendations to Executives and departments on HR planning, workforce trends and human capital management matters.
Provide strategic advice and support to departments on Human Resource Administration, Human Resource Development and Performance Management and Development Systems (PMDS) for employees at SMS and Levels 1–12.
Monitor compliance with HR legislative and regulatory prescripts and provide consolidated quarterly and annual reports on HR management practices across the GPG.
Manage the human, financial and other resources of the Directorate to ensure the effective and efficient delivery of services.
